Loretta Lynn Cancels Some Tour Dates After Fall
NASHVILLE, Tenn. Country music star Loretta Lynn has postponed shows after
suffering injuries in a fall that will require minor surgery. Lynn's injuries
were described as not serious, but a statement posted on her website on
Wednesday said her doctors have advised her to stay off the road until she's
made
a full recovery. The 84-year-old singer and songwriter was not able to perform
during a Labor Day weekend show at her home in Hurricane Mills, Tennessee,
and three upcoming shows in September have been postponed. The "Coal Miner's
Daughter" released her first studio album in a decade earlier this year, called
"Full Circle. She continues to tour regularly.
